The Pembrokeshire Coast National Park Authority has appointed Nicola Gandy as its new development management team leader.
Nicola moves to the authority having previously fulfilled a number of planning roles at Bridgend County Borough Council over a period of 12 years.
National Park Authority director of park direction and planning, Jane Gibson, said: “We are delighted to have appointed Nicola to this extremely important role. She brings with her vast experience from every level of the planning service and a range of new ideas.”
Nicola will be heading the team responsible for the delivery of the authority’s statutory development management (control) planning function, guiding applicants through the planning process.
She takes over at a time when the authority’s performance is in the top four in Wales, with over 93 per cent of all applications being determined within the eight-week Welsh Government target.
Nicola commented: “I’ve visited the Pembrokeshire Coast many times, but am looking forward to getting to know the area in more detail. I’ll be heading up the team to install new software to aid our efficiency and to make the planning function of the National Park more accessible to the public.
“This will complement the already successful weekly planning surgery and the pre-application service for which there is a fee.”
The planning surgery takes place every Thursday from 10 am - 4 pm at the Pembrokeshire Coast National Park Authority Headquarters at Llanion Park, Pembroke Dock.
